Declaration of Independence

Remember Calvin Coolidge’s history lesson, and warning, regarding the spirit that animated America’s founding document.

The Fourth of July in 1926 was the 150th anniversary of the signing of the Declaration of Independence. United States President Calvin Coolidge took the occasion to give a speech celebrating the charter.

In this time of poisonous partisanship, political turbulence and bewildering social change, this speech is a refreshing reminder of the principles that established this country.
